HVAC Line Set Replacement: What You Need to Know
Replacing your cooling line set can seem like a significant undertaking , but understanding the fundamentals will help you to make the procedure . The refrigerant lines carries refrigerant between your external air conditioner and your interior system. Over time, these lines can degrade, develop leaks, or get damaged, impacting efficiency and potentially risking the environment . A professional HVAC technician should handle this substitution , as it involves specialized tools and training regarding refrigerant handling and correct equipment integrity.
Decoding AC Linesets: Types, Sizes, and Best Practices
Understanding your air conditioning linesets is vital for efficient setup . Typically , these involve copper piping connecting the outdoor unit to a evaporator . Lineset sizes depend based on a unit's power and length – refer to the specifications for correct sizing . Proper procedures emphasize sufficient slope to allow water flow, secure support to reduce vibration , and thorough leak testing upon finalization.

Troubleshooting HVAC Line Set Issues: Leaks & Performance
Diagnosing problems with your HVAC system's line set can be tricky , especially when encountering both copper line set for air conditioner refrigerant losses and poor output. Frequent signs include lower cooling performance, higher energy bills , or the clear sound of a hissing noise . Likely causes range from minor punctures to severe corrosion, and a careful inspection, often requiring specialized tools , is crucial to identify the exact source and implement the correct solution.
Choosing the Right Line Set for Your HVAC System
Selecting the correct line set for the HVAC installation is critical for optimal operation . Evaluate elements such as your temperature capacity , gas type being employed , and distance of refrigerant pipes . A wrong line assembly may lead to lower efficiency , higher energy costs , and even probable damage to your HVAC equipment . Always speak to a qualified HVAC contractor for assistance on the right line solution for your unique needs.
